I had ZoneAlarm installed, and had serious problems with it. It was stopping my computer from hibernating, going into stand by, shutting down, and even causing long start up delays, so I decided to get rid of it again.
You D-Link 502 is indeed a router, and it does have a firewall built into it. One thing to be aware of is that with the D-Link 502, newer firmware meant that it will respond to pings instead of appearing to not exist as the old firmware did. I am not sure why this happens, but it may have been fixed in the GEN-II version of the router.
